Bahamas Airport Overview

Lynden Pindling International Airport, known as LPIA, serves as the largest airport in the Bahamas and is the main international gateway to this beautiful archipelago. Situated on the western side of New Providence Island, just a short distance from Nassau, the airport plays a crucial role in connecting travelers from various parts of the world to the laid-back charm of the Bahamas. With coordinates of 25°02′20″N and 077°27′58″W, it makes for a convenient entry point for those looking to soak up the sun or explore the vibrant culture of the islands.

As a hub for several local airlines, including Bahamasair, Western Air, and Pineapple Air, LPIA boasts a steady flow of both domestic and international flights. Carrying out its operations under the ownership of the Nassau Airport Development Company, the airport is managed by the Vantage Airport Group, ensuring that it maintains a high standard of cleanliness and efficiency. Passengers often find their experience at LPIA to be welcoming, thanks in part to the dedicated staff that strive to assist travelers as they arrive or depart.

LPIA’s design combines functionality with modern aesthetics. Travelers can enjoy a relatively small airport layout, which allows for easier navigation between terminals and gates. The terminal facilities include a range of amenities and services, such as duty-free shops stocked with locally made gifts, restaurants, and lounges. When To Visit Bahamas Airport

Choosing the right time to visit Lynden Pindling International Airport largely depends on your personal preferences, and what type of experience you seek. The Bahamas enjoys a tropical climate characterized by warm temperatures throughout the year. However, peak tourist season typically falls between December and April, coinciding with winter months in many other parts of the world. During this high season, travelers flock to the islands seeking respite from the cold, leading to packed flights and higher accommodation rates.

For those looking to avoid the crowds and potentially save on travel expenses, consider visiting during the shoulder seasons, which occur in late spring (May – June) and early fall (September – November). At this time, visitors can experience the beauty of the islands without the overwhelming number of tourists. Also, flights and hotels may offer more competitive pricing during these periods as many people tend to travel during the peak season.

However, it is essential to keep in mind that the Bahamas is also subject to hurricane season, which runs from June 1st to November 30th. During this time, travelers should keep an eye on weather forecasts and advisories. That said, significant storms are less common, and visiting during this time can allow for lower rates and more relaxed atmospheres at popular attractions.

Amenities and Facilities in Bahamas Airport

Lynden Pindling International Airport is equipped with numerous amenities and facilities designed to enhance the travel experience for its visitors. Upon entering the airport, travelers are greeted by a clean and modern environment that facilitates easy navigation. Various services cater to the needs of international and domestic passengers alike, making it convenient to explore or relax while waiting for flights.

The airport features a variety of duty-free shops, including renowned offerings such as Cays News and Gifts, Pirana Joe, and the ‘Made in Bahamas’ shop. These stores provide travelers with a chance to purchase unique souvenirs, local crafts, and beautiful Bahamian jewelry. Purchasing items from these shops not only allows travelers to take home a piece of the Bahamas but also supports local artisans and businesses.

In terms of dining options, LPIA does not disappoint. Visitors can find chains such as Quiznos and Wendy’s alongside local favorites like a sushi bar and a pizza place. Dunkin’ Donuts and TCBY Yogurt offer quick treats for those in a rush. Travelers who desire a more substantial meal can visit the Rhythm Café, the only sit-down restaurant in the airport featuring a full bar. This dining option allows visitors to enjoy local cuisine and beverages while soaking in the Bahamian atmosphere.

For those seeking a more peaceful place to wait for their flight, the Lignum Lounge serves as a tranquil retreat. This lounge offers complimentary Wi-Fi and outdoor patios where passengers can unwind in a comfortable setting. The ambiance is designed to help travelers relax before their onward journey, making it an excellent experience for individuals and families alike.

There is also a Priority Pass Lounge, the Graycliff Lounge, which is currently closed for remodeling as of 2024. When operating, this lounge offered buffet-style meals and both indoor and outdoor seating. Once reopened, it will provide an additional option for passengers seeking a relaxing space to wait for their flights.

How to Get to Bahamas Airport

Getting to Lynden Pindling International Airport is relatively simple due to its accessible location near the capital city of Nassau. If you’re already in New Providence Island or are visiting nearby islands, you can easily reach the airport by taking a taxi, ride-sharing service, or rental car.

For travelers staying in downtown Nassau, a taxi will typically cost between $25 to $35, depending on your exact location and the time of day. Additionally, several shuttle services operate from local hotels and resorts, providing seamless transportation to the airport for their guests. If you plan to rent a car, various rental agencies are located at the airport, making for a hassle-free experience upon your arrival and departure.

For those traveling from other islands in the Bahamas, domestic flights are available to LPIA through local airlines such as Bahamasair and Western Air. This option facilitates easy access to the airport for travelers coming from other parts of the country.

Nearby Attractions to Check Out

John Watling’s Distillery

Just a short distance from the airport, John Watling’s Distillery offers visitors a chance to experience the traditional production of rum in the Bahamas. Set in a historic estate, guests can partake in guided tours that take them through the distillation process while learning about the history and significance of rum production in Bahamian culture. After the tour, visitors often enjoy tasting samples of the delicious local spirits produced on-site.

This attraction provides a perfect opportunity for those interested in learning about the local flavors of the Bahamas and is an excellent spot for trying a classic Bahamian cocktail. Visitors will appreciate the beautiful surroundings of the estate, making it a perfect place to relax and enjoy some downtime after arriving at the airport.

Address: John Watling’s Distillery, 17 Delancy Street, Nassau, New Providence, Bahamas

Ardastra Gardens & Zoo

The Ardastra Gardens & Zoo is another must-visit attraction near LPIA. Known for its conservation efforts and wildlife preservation, this zoo showcases a variety of exotic and native animals, including the famous flamingos that provide vivid splashes of color throughout the gardens. The zoo promotes education and awareness regarding the importance of wildlife preservation, making it a worthwhile stop for families and animal lovers.

In addition to the animal exhibits, visitors can wander through the beautifully landscaped gardens filled with tropical plants and flowers. The serene environment is perfect for enjoying a leisurely stroll and enjoying the abundance of nature that fills the gardens. A visit to Ardastra Gardens & Zoo is an enriching experience that highlights the need to protect the diverse fauna of the Bahamas while also providing ample opportunities for fun and adventure.

Address: Ardastra Gardens & Zoo, Chippingham Road, Nassau, New Providence, Bahamas
